The Golden Dilemma: Should You Really Be Eating Gold?


In today's culinary landscape, luxury meets cuisine as celebrity chef Ranveer Brar's 24K gold tadka dal takes social media by storm. But amidst the glitter and glamor, a question lingers: is eating gold actually safe? Let's delve into the golden world of edible gold, its implications on health, and the expert insights from gastroenterologists at Artemis Hospitals.

Yes, You Can Eat Gold... But Should You?

Experts assert that edible gold is indeed safe for consumption, primarily used for garnishing and elevating the aesthetic appeal of dishes. However, before you indulge in the latest trend of gold-infused delicacies, it's crucial to understand the nuances.

Dr. Pawan Rawal, a distinguished gastroenterologist at Artemis Hospital, emphasizes that edible gold, when in its purest form, is biologically inert. This means it passes through the digestive system without being absorbed, rendering it harmless to the body. However, despite its safety, gold holds no nutritional value, offering mere visual extravagance rather than tangible health benefits.

While gold has been utilized in Ayurveda for centuries, modern scientific evidence regarding its health effects remains limited. While it's generally safe in small quantities, excessive consumption can potentially lead to toxicity, highlighting the importance of moderation and purity.

The Art of Gold in Cuisine: A Chef's Perspective

Chef Neha Deepak Shah, acknowledges the allure of edible gold in desserts for its aesthetic appeal. However, she notes that gold imparts no discernible flavor, merely adding a metallic taste. Despite its popularity, she cautions against falling prey to gimmicky gold-infused dishes, emphasizing the significance of substance over style.

But Is It a New Phenomenon?

Far from being a modern trend, the integration of gold into culinary practices traces back to ancient civilizations, particularly in India. Historically, gold adorned royal dining tables, permeating into food through gold-plated utensils and garnishes. Additionally, gold was incorporated into medicinal elixirs, believed to possess therapeutic properties.
